Job description

Delta One Trader - South African Equities

Embark on a dynamic career with J.P. Morgan's South African Delta One business, where you can leverage your expertise in equity markets to drive impactful trading strategies and risk management.

Job Summary

As a Delta One Trader within the Equity Derivatives Group, you will play a pivotal role in pricing and executing client requests for Delta One products. You will manage risk exposures related to index and swap books, analyze earnings forecasts, and generate trade ideas through quantitative analysis. Your role will involve direct management of entity funding and optimizing desk inventory while actively trading on exchanges and in the inter-dealer broker market.

Collaborate with a team that values innovation and precision, contributing to the growth of our South African Delta One business. Your insights will shape trading strategies and enhance our market presence.

Job Responsibilities

  • Actively price and execute client requests for all Delta One products.
  • Manage risk exposures (e.g., delta, rho, mu) applicable to index and swap books.
  • Analyze earnings forecasts and financial situations of in-scope companies to forecast dividend amounts.
  • Generate trade ideas based on quantitative analysis of companies and events.
  • Manage entity funding and work on optimizing desk inventory.
  • Analyze corporate actions and index-related events.
  • Trade actively on exchanges as well as in the inter-dealer broker market.
